Subject: [PATCH] dmaengine: sh: rz-dmac: Protect the driver specific lists

The driver lists (ld_free, ld_queue) are used in
rz_dmac_free_chan_resources(), rz_dmac_terminate_all(),
rz_dmac_issue_pending(), and rz_dmac_irq_handler_thread(), all under
the virtual channel lock. Take the same lock in rz_dmac_prep_slave_sg()
and rz_dmac_prep_dma_memcpy() as well to avoid concurrency issues, since
these functions also check whether the lists are empty and update or
remove list entries.

diff --git a/drivers/dma/sh/rz-dmac.c b/drivers/dma/sh/rz-dmac.c
index d84ca551b2bf..089e1ab29159 100644
--- a/drivers/dma/sh/rz-dmac.c
+++ b/drivers/dma/sh/rz-dmac.c
@@ -10,6 +10,7 @@
  */
 
 #include <linux/bitfield.h>
+#include <linux/cleanup.h>
 #include <linux/dma-mapping.h>
 #include <linux/dmaengine.h>
 #include <linux/interrupt.h>
@@ -447,6 +448,7 @@ static int rz_dmac_alloc_chan_resources(struct dma_chan *chan)
 		if (!desc)
 			break;
 
+		/* No need to lock. This is called only for the 1st client. */
 		list_add_tail(&desc->node, &channel->ld_free);
 		channel->descs_allocated++;
 	}
@@ -502,18 +504,21 @@ rz_dmac_prep_dma_memcpy(struct dma_chan *chan, dma_addr_t dest, dma_addr_t src,
 	dev_dbg(dmac->dev, "%s channel: %d src=0x%pad dst=0x%pad len=%zu\n",
 		__func__, channel->index, &src, &dest, len);
 
-	if (list_empty(&channel->ld_free))
-		return NULL;
+	scoped_guard(spinlock_irqsave, &channel->vc.lock) {
+		if (list_empty(&channel->ld_free))
+			return NULL;
 
-	desc = list_first_entry(&channel->ld_free, struct rz_dmac_desc, node);
+		desc = list_first_entry(&channel->ld_free, struct rz_dmac_desc, node);
 
-	desc->type = RZ_DMAC_DESC_MEMCPY;
-	desc->src = src;
-	desc->dest = dest;
-	desc->len = len;
-	desc->direction = DMA_MEM_TO_MEM;
+		desc->type = RZ_DMAC_DESC_MEMCPY;
+		desc->src = src;
+		desc->dest = dest;
+		desc->len = len;
+		desc->direction = DMA_MEM_TO_MEM;
+
+		list_move_tail(channel->ld_free.next, &channel->ld_queue);
+	}
 
-	list_move_tail(channel->ld_free.next, &channel->ld_queue);
 	return vchan_tx_prep(&channel->vc, &desc->vd, flags);
 }
 
@@ -529,27 +534,29 @@ rz_dmac_prep_slave_sg(struct dma_chan *chan, struct scatterlist *sgl,
 	int dma_length = 0;
 	int i = 0;
 
-	if (list_empty(&channel->ld_free))
-		return NULL;
+	scoped_guard(spinlock_irqsave, &channel->vc.lock) {
+		if (list_empty(&channel->ld_free))
+			return NULL;
 
-	desc = list_first_entry(&channel->ld_free, struct rz_dmac_desc, node);
+		desc = list_first_entry(&channel->ld_free, struct rz_dmac_desc, node);
 
-	for_each_sg(sgl, sg, sg_len, i) {
-		dma_length += sg_dma_len(sg);
+		for_each_sg(sgl, sg, sg_len, i)
+			dma_length += sg_dma_len(sg);
+
+		desc->type = RZ_DMAC_DESC_SLAVE_SG;
+		desc->sg = sgl;
+		desc->sgcount = sg_len;
+		desc->len = dma_length;
+		desc->direction = direction;
+
+		if (direction == DMA_DEV_TO_MEM)
+			desc->src = channel->src_per_address;
+		else
+			desc->dest = channel->dst_per_address;
+
+		list_move_tail(channel->ld_free.next, &channel->ld_queue);
 	}
 
-	desc->type = RZ_DMAC_DESC_SLAVE_SG;
-	desc->sg = sgl;
-	desc->sgcount = sg_len;
-	desc->len = dma_length;
-	desc->direction = direction;
-
-	if (direction == DMA_DEV_TO_MEM)
-		desc->src = channel->src_per_address;
-	else
-		desc->dest = channel->dst_per_address;
-
-	list_move_tail(channel->ld_free.next, &channel->ld_queue);
 	return vchan_tx_prep(&channel->vc, &desc->vd, flags);
 }
